Cracked Glass

A lawnmowers' puddle or a torrential downpour or a child's ball can all cause a crack to appear in a window. Fortunately, if you spot cracks in the window early, they're relatively easy to repair yourself. However, if they're too large that the glass is damaged and could break at any moment, you'll want to contact an expert.

When it comes to doors and windows there are two options you can take: a temporary fix using resin and putty, or a more extensive repair job that requires the use of replacement windows and glass. The former is likely to be better suited to your needs and your budget, depending on the circumstances.

For tiny cracks in the window repairs near me, you'll need to invest in some two-part epoxy. It consists of a resin and a hardener that must be mixed together in order to work. A putty blade is also required to apply the epoxy. You can purchase these tools on the internet or in a hardware store. Typically epoxy will be sold in a double-cylinder syringe which regulates the flow of each substance and ensures it stays at the right ratio.

Make sure that the crack is clean, dry and free of debris before applying the epoxy. With your putty use a gentle pressure to press the epoxy into the crack. After a short time the epoxy will be hardened and it will be more difficult to see any cracks. To get rid of any excess epoxy, you will have to wipe it off with an acetone-soaked fabric.

Some companies claim a repaired crack is virtually undetectable. However, this isn't always the situation. Even a repaired crack is usually noticeable, especially if it was previously very deep or extensive. It is essential to stop the crack from getting bigger So, be sure to act fast.

doorpanels-300x200.jpgSagging Frame

Sagging frames can be difficult to open and close. They can also scrape against the jambs of doors. This could cause your uPVC Door Repair to look shabby, damaged and even leave a mark on the door. Fortunately, there are some quick ways to fix the issue.

The most frequent cause of sliding is loose or worn screws on the top hinge. Alternatively, older homes often have a single door that is supported by only one hinge. This can be corrected by tightening or replacing the top hinge screws.

If the issue is caused by an shim or spacer it can be removed by removing the hinge. Then, you can easily remove the shim and dispose of it. Sometimes a thin piece of metal or cardboard is added to the hinge leaf to ensure that the door fits the frame more easily. Sometimes, a shim may get stuck under the hinge so that you can't see it.

Broken Hinges

The majority of homes in the UK utilizes uPVC or aluminium windows that open via hinges. If you notice drafts or gaps or you have trouble opening your windows, this could indicate that hinges require to be replaced.

A faulty window hinge can cost you $75 to $200 if it needs to be replaced professionally. The price varies based on the kind of hinge you need and how many hinges need repairing. For instance, tilt and turn windows are more expensive to repair than simple side opening uPVC or aluminium windows.

The hinge consists of a sleeve and knuckle. The sleeve is the round section that surrounds the pin, securing it in the right position. The knuckle forms the middle part of the hinge and is responsible for moving it. The pin is a rod of a cylindrical shape that passes through the knuckle to join the two leaves.

It's easy to prevent window hinges from breaking by executing regular maintenance. This includes cleaning the friction stay and regularly lubricating metal components and taking out dirt. This will help the hinges last longer and door repair perform better.
